The AR10 is restricted as a variant of the AR15 even though the AR10 preceded the AR15.
That's because the 'new' AR10(A and B models) ARE based off the Ar15. The Ar15 is based off the original AR10.
If someone built an original (semi-auto) pattern AR10 it would be non-res
Who said that the AR-10 lower is non-restricted?
An original lower will be prohibited, a current one will be restricted.
